Job Summary: This position within the Americas HR Service Center is responsible for delivering expert-level support in Employee Relations, Policy Management, and ADA compliance in a corporate setting. The role partners closely with employees, people leaders, HR Strategic Business Partners, and HR Centers of Excellence (COEs) to resolve complex work matters, ensure legal and policy compliance and promote a fair and productive work environment. In addition to core operational responsibilities, this role leads and contributes to HR projects and initiatives as assigned, including process improvements, policy enhancements, training development and facilitation, and enterprise-wide HR programs that support evolving business needs and workforce strategies.
